Welcome to the Sketchforge team. Since Tuesday's deploy, the diagram editor's undo/redo stack intermittently fails to restore after a page reload. The history service persists operation logs to a dedicated database, and the logs show repeated connection refusals during peak hours, likely a pool exhaustion issue rather than network trouble. Please reproduce by opening any diagram, making five edits, and reloading. To inspect the operation logs directly, connect to the history database using the string below.

primary connection of yagep-kahip = redis://giliel_svc:zYiKsLL2PLpfPL@db-348f.xolmarsys.corp:5432/fenwyn

Subject: RestockPilot cut-over complete

Hi Marlena,

The RestockPilot planner cut-over finished at 06:40 this morning. Route generation for all Veldhaven depots now runs on the new scheduler, and the legacy cron jobs have been disabled. Restock forecasts for the pilot machines matched expectations within 2%, and no alerts fired overnight. The old instance stays warm for one week as a fallback. For your release records, the active production configuration is as follows.

settings of kageg-yawig:
[casix]
host = casix.tolvaqlabs.corp
user = casix_svc
database = casix_prod

MINUTES — Management Meeting

Attendees: Sales leadership, exec sponsors.

Topic: Possible acquisition of Brindlehook Systems. Diligence underway; valuation range agreed internally. Overlap with our Quartz line considered manageable. No customer communication until term sheet signed. Pipeline forecasts unaffected for now; continue business as usual. Keep this off all external calls. The following note captures the board's current position.

board note of kafog-bajep: Briathek Partners is in early talks to buy Aldaelek Group for about $47.1 million. The Ulaath launch date is September 4, and nothing goes to the press before then.